Season 9 introduces substantial balance changes that have reshaped the competitive landscape. The most significant shift involves the nerf to Overpower mechanics, which has forced many builds to adapt toward damage-over-time strategies and skill-based rotations.

Lunging Strike stands as the sole Barbarian representation in our top-tier rankings. Regrettably, numerous previously dominant Barbarian configurations have fallen out of favor, but Lunging Strike has fortunately emerged as a potent alternative for the class.
This specialized setup emphasizes basic attack utilization while incorporating Paingorger’s Gauntlets to amplify your fundamental skill ranks. When you inflict damage on enemies using any non-basic ability, you apply a distinctive mark that persists for 3 seconds. Subsequently, when you strike marked targets with basic skills, the damage reverberates across all affected enemies simultaneously. The strategic essence involves tagging multiple adversaries with secondary skills before executing your Lunging Strike to optimize area damage potential.
Strategic gear combination with Hooves of the Mountain God boots provides substantial attack speed enhancement for basic abilities. When activating a basic skill at maximum fury capacity, your fury gradually depletes until exhausted, converting your basic attacks into cleaving strikes that deal 100% increased damage. This mechanical transformation enables seamless transition from single-target focus to effective area-of-effect clearing capabilities.
Lunging Strike inherently functions as an effective gap-closing mechanism, making it an organic mobility tool within your arsenal. This configuration delivers both exceptional performance and highly engaging gameplay dynamics.
Minion-focused Necromancer has secured its position within the elite rankings, primarily due to The Hand of Naz unique item. This configuration specializes in skeletal mage minions. Through sacrificing both warrior skeletons and golem companions, you gain one additional skeletal mage for each minion sacrificed.
When a skeletal mage successfully attacks enemies 25 times without being destroyed, it evolves into a Skeletal Arch Mage. These enhanced arch mages possess teleportation capabilities for evading danger when threatened, and their attacks can occasionally shatter upon impact, dealing 100% increased damage to the primary target and up to three additional enemies. In this specialized setup, your traditional minion tanking role reverses—you become the protective barrier for your arch mages.
Incorporating the Ring of Mendeln remains essential for this configuration. This legendary item has experienced considerable evolution throughout Diablo 4’s development, but currently appears fully operational. It provides crucial summon attack speed enhancements and boosts your Skeletal Mage Mastery ranks. The defining characteristic involves every sixth attack from each minion becoming empowered, dealing substantially increased physical damage. These enhanced strikes deliver devastating burst damage from your mage contingent.
The pure summoner Necromancer archetype now represents top-tier performance potential!
This shadow damage-over-time Necromancer configuration centers around Blight mechanics. With this arrangement, you should equip Ebonpiercer. This item grants multiple additional ranks to Blight while increasing the probability for Blight projectiles to duplicate their casting. Additionally, Blight discharges four smaller projectiles that penetrate enemy formations, applying shadow damage over time. When confronting single targets, you can effectively ‘shotgun’ enemies through precise positioning, enabling all projectiles to strike the same target simultaneously.
Blood Wave has experienced ranking reduction after previously occupying the second position during Season 8. Despite receiving substantial nerf adjustments, Blood Wave maintains its status among the most powerful Necromancer configurations and demonstrates remarkable versatility across various gameplay situations.
Blood Wave fully capitalizes on the shadow damage buffs, converting it into a darkness skill to activate all available synergies. Depending on your current activity focus, Blood Wave can be modified for speedrunning approaches or simplified content clearing. However, for Pit progression optimization, a shadow damage-over-time variation is emerging as the premier choice.
The Overpower mechanic has undergone significant weakening, which previously served as the primary damage source for Blood Wave. Currently, the Blood Wave configuration is transitioning away from Overpower dependency and now concentrates entirely on scaling damage-over-time effects. The gameplay approach has transformed dramatically; the build no longer emphasizes blood orb collection and instead focuses on deploying Desecrated Ground across combat arenas.
Fleshrender configuration revolves around the Fleshrender unique item. When you activate any defensive skill, it inflicts substantial damage on nearby poisoned enemies, scaling by 50% for every 100 willpower you possess. The fundamental gameplay involves rapidly cycling defensive abilities against poisoned targets to generate massive area damage output.
Essential skills include Earthen Bulwark, Cyclone Armor, Blood Howl, and Debilitating Roar. You’ll continuously employ these capabilities, shouting and roaring until your adversaries are vanquished.
This build excels as you advance through content, demanding high-quality gear and optimized Paragon progression since damage output directly scales with willpower attributes. For each 100 willpower accumulated, your damage potential increases proportionally. The gear synergy design focuses on minimizing defensive skill cooldowns, permitting their utilization as frequently as possible.
Pulverize has consistently represented a reliable early-game Druid configuration; while it may not have demonstrated exceptional performance historically, it has maintained consistent effectiveness. However, within the current endgame environment, it transforms into a powerful alternative, particularly with the introduction of the new unique item, Rotting Lightbringer.
When no poison puddles exist in your vicinity, Pulverize generates a toxic pool that guarantees Overpower effects and delivers a multiple of its standard damage as poisoning over 7 seconds. Additionally, Pulverize causes all adjacent puddles to splash a percentage of their cumulative damage within their effective area. This item additionally provides elevated probability for Pulverize to strike twice consecutively, enabling substantial area-of-effect damage as you establish your poison zones.
This configuration offers straightforward execution and operates effectively at range, courtesy of the Shockwave Aspect enabling Pulverize to project a damaging shockwave. Critical implementation detail: Pulverize initially inflicts area damage surrounding your character, then releases a shockwave that extends further outward. Through precise positioning against individual targets, you can guarantee both the melee impact and shockwave strike the identical enemy, optimizing your damage efficiency against boss encounters.
Although Overpower received significant nerfing in Season 9, it continues to play an essential role within this configuration by facilitating multiple Overpower occurrences.
Hydra delivers exceptional entertainment value while effectively utilizing the new unique item, Ophidian Iris. Hydra now functions as a core skill, permitting comprehensive synergy development around it. It consistently summons a three-headed hydra, and its projectiles detonate upon impact. For each supplementary head beyond the initial three, the Hydra increases in size and damage output, resulting in some impressively large hydra manifestations! You can maintain up to 18 heads simultaneously on a Hydra, translating to substantially enlarged assault capabilities.
You’ll additionally want to combine this configuration with the Serpentine Aspect (including Serpentine Energy Staff), which amplifies Hydra’s damage based on your available mana pool during summoning. Consequently, you should cast it while maintaining maximum mana capacity. To maximize this interaction, accumulate effects that enhance your maximum mana attributes, employing items such as Elixir of Resourcefulness 2, to acquire additional power. Remember that you can only maintain two active Hydra summons simultaneously, with each Hydra persisting for 10 seconds. Overall, this configuration’s playstyle remains relatively relaxed and accessible.
This season, Spiritborn characters have acquired a new equipment option, Balazan’s Maxtlatl. With each offensive action, this item damages surrounding enemies for a percentage of your Thorns attribute and delivers 100% of this damage as poisoning over 3 seconds. Each instance you’ve retaliated using Thorns for 5 seconds, the poisoning damage escalates by 100%, reaching a maximum of 300%.
This poisoning damage-over-time effect synergizes perfectly with the Noxious Resonance passive ability. Your critical strikes will trigger the poisoning effect on an enemy to explode, inflicting 180% of the cumulative poisoning instantly to that target and 20% of the detonation damage to adjacent enemies before eliminating the poisoning effect from the primary target. This means you’re continuously applying poison damage then activating explosive damage across multiple adversaries.
Additionally, Razorplate proves advantageous within this configuration, enabling substantial Thorns damage accumulation. You’ll additionally employ the Jaguar spirit within Spirit Hall. Every fifteenth instance you inflict direct damage to an enemy using a Jaguar skill, it releases an additional strike that deals 50% of the damage you’ve delivered to them within the preceding 0.5 seconds. Precise timing of your damage amplification windows remains crucial for optimizing this configuration’s performance.
To enhance your damage windows, you’ll need to utilize the QAX Rune of Invocation. Activating any skill besides basic abilities will consume your entire primary resource pool to augment your damage by up to 100% for 1 second. Ensure that your Jaguar snapshot captures that 100% damage enhancement.
Another critical element you desire within that snapshot involves the Aspect of Plains Power. Through Lucky Hit occurrences, you’ll generate a mystical circle upon the ground. If you position yourself within that circle, your damage increases by 5% for each ferocity stack you maintain, producing a substantial damage multiplier. You additionally want to guarantee that your The Hunter (Ultimate) ability activates during that damage window, because it’s capturing all damage you’re dealing within the last 0.5 seconds.
If you’re operating this configuration without meticulous attention, you might question why your damage output fluctuates so significantly. This configuration possesses an elevated skill ceiling, demanding focused execution and mastery of timing subtleties.
